1/72 #00824 Hasegawa
![]() Grumman S2F-1 (S-2A) Tracker Early Paint Scheme Sealed NM Injection Molded old | |||
| Still factory sealed. From 2006. Well molded kit from older molds. Has markings for the US Navy. Kit features cockpit detail, retractable radome, optional position landing gear and rotating props. Over 1000 Trackers were completed for the Navy as carrier-based submarine hunters. Grumman was awarded the contract in 1950, and in 1952 the first XS2F-1 flew. The large belly radome contained the PAS-38 search radar and the AWQ-10 MAD detector was in the tail. ALD-3 ECM performed DF (direction finding) duties, and the 70 million candle power spotlight lit up targets at night. Sonobuoys were held in both engine nacelles and offensive weapons included acoustic torpedoes, depth charges, rockets and conventional bombs. Trackers saw service in several other Navies including Canada. | |||
